Sarah has built a scale model of a bridge. The bridge is 56ft across and 22ft wide. Sarah’s model is 8in across and 2.5 in. wide. Is Sarah’s model a trye model of the bridge? Explain

Mercury:

I'm guessing it's supposed to say "true" model not "trye" model? in that case, you just need to see whether 56 feet by 22 feet is proportional to 8 inch by 2.5 inch you can try dividing the longer dimension/smaller dimension for both cases and see if they're equal (basically, 56/22 vs. 8/2.5)
